WANTED : Rear vent switch for my '67 Newport. It has 3 nipples on it, one on mine is broken off, the other 2 look like they've already been super glued back into place. Does anyone have one with all 3 nipples intact and original? If I can't find one obviously I'll try gluing the nipples back on but I'd like to find one that's still intact.

Part # 2770554

JB Weld will work on that. You could super glue it, to keep it in place then,use the JB weld and let it cure for 24 hrs. Reinforce the other two while you're
at it.

For plastic parts I use JB Weld Super Weld. It's a liquid super duty glue in a little squirt bottle. It is on the thick side like a gel and works great. Once it cures then I use an epoxy made specifically for plastic. JB Weld, Gorilla Glue, etc. all make them.
